
Lang Named Third Team All-Big Ten
11/4/2025 1:00:00 PM | Women's Soccer
ROSEMONT, Ill. -- Senior midfielder Jenna Lang was named to the All-Big Ten third team, the conference announced Tuesday (Nov. 4) afternoon. Lang earned her first career postseason honor after matching her career high with 10 points on the season, including a new personal-best four assists, and is the first third-team selection for Michigan since Avery Kalitta and Sammi Woods in 2023.
Lang led the Wolverines through the heart of Big Ten play, not logging her first point of the season until an assist against Nebraska on Sept. 25 but finishing ninth in the conference with 10 total points and 0.91 points per game.
The Columbus, Ind., product rounded out the regular season with four assists in Big Ten play, tied for the second most among conference field players. Her four-point game at Maryland on Oct. 16 was also tied for the fourth-highest scoring game of the season in the Big Ten conference in 2025.
In addition, Gabrielle Prych was named Michigan's Sportsmanship Award honoree.
